From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Abbreviator \Ab*bre"vi*a`tor\, n. [LL.: cf. F. abbr['e]viateur.]
     1. One who abbreviates or shortens.
        [1913 Webster]
  
     2. One of a college of seventy-two officers of the papal
        court whose duty is to make a short minute of a decision


        on a petition, or reply of the pope to a letter, and
        afterwards expand the minute into official form.
        [1913 Webster]

From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:

  abbreviator
       n : one who shortens or abridges or condenses a written work
           [syn: {abridger}]
